Senior Logistics Planner, Level III Associate

Booz Allen Hamilton
01.2009 - 01.2012
  • Led all aspects of orchestrating the logistical move of $1.2B in military equipment of the Armor Center and School relocation from Fort Knox, KY, to Fort Benning, GA, including distribution, inventory control, cost accounting, expense control, and management of $86M budget. Assisted in the management of numerous large military facilities including military barracks, dining, recreation and administrative spaces in two states. Directed and managed administrative and operational functions of reception, security, mail services, maintenance operations, hospitality and relocation management. Collaborated with 30+ agencies and involved organizations, including military contractors and Army Corps of Engineers.
  • Led all planning and executing efforts associated with logistics and transportation management, distribution and relocation of major military equipment, including trucks, tanks, and weapons over 14 months; some going to Fort Benning and to other locations in AL and VA.
  • Executed safe movement of 1,452 trucks and 148 railcars, the largest movement of equipment that was covered in local media and by CNN.
  • Negotiated a major contract that reduced costs, increased productivity and saved the US Army more than $30M in transportation and operations costs.
